Hello Mr, if you have problems with a (possibly) MySQL attack you can bind your mysql server to 127.0.0.1
I know, in this way you cannot be able to connect via navicat, but just use a bit of brain, you can simply use a web tool like phpmyadmin and secure the access using .htaccess

my.cnf
bind-address = 127.0.0.1
